i dont personally use any of these specifically but if i were buying for a person with arthritis … id go for an electric chopper option vs one that requires manual manipulation.
so the first and 2nd seem like they will need a lot of wrist/finger use … difficult for anyone with significant arthritis. Cant tell if the last one is manual or not?
